Output a528a803b4d65024a7fd30e8089f7de1720d3b8d0ff3c5c09d2e11184da8e14f:33

value
4336491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 538860318067f7b07af15dc17f239dd817ce5d6a OP_EQUALVERIFY OP_CHECKSIG
address
18cgTUafFtw2onUgaoUj96ozCofHuoNBkZ
transaction
a528a803b4d65024a7fd30e8089f7de1720d3b8d0ff3c5c09d2e11184da8e14f
confirmations
399445
spent
true